Your Italian tutor:
Pauline is our Italian teacher. Living in Italy as a child, Pauline is fluent in Italian. She runs Italian for Beginners and Follow-on Italian Evening Classes, as well as teaches students on a one-to-one basis in various locations, at home or at work, wherever is convenient.
She started teaching English to Italian companies at the Benedict School in Modena in 1976 and has taught and interpreted both English and Italian at a very intense level for many years (besides having lived and set up businesses over 25 years in both countries). With her vast experience Pauline has abundant knowledge of lots of ‘quirky tips’ to help you remember things easily.
